Within only one year Vossloh Kiepe has succeeded in reducing its emission of CO₂ by 70.4 tons/year and in reducing its costs by 30,000 euros by optimising processes and by realising simple behaviour modifications and adaptations!
ÖKOPROFIT® is a cooperative approach between the local authority, local companies as well as regional and supra-regional partners. The concept combines yield with ecological benefit and is a recognised instrument to e.g. improve climate protection in companies and public institutions.

The present success was mainly achieved with the help of the employees of Vossloh Kiepe, who took up and realised the very different modification proposals with great commitment. Thus, e.g. an exhaust system was always switched off during breaks. This simple push of a button saved about 1 000 euros because the power consumption was reduced by 5 500 kWh. Moreover, the water heating in the social and sanitary areas was adjusted by setting the under-sink water heaters to 35 °C, which reduced the costs by about 4 500 euros per year.
Measures like the stepwise modernisation and adaptation of the lighting to the actual need, which have been initiated and will be concluded in the next few months, will probably save about 17 500 euros.
Moreover, the heating systems, the light in the halls and the waste disposal are going to be optimised.
